Genes Promoting Lung Cancer May Not Normalize When Smoking Stops
VANCOUVER, British Columbia — For some genes involved in the development of lung cancer, smoking may be forever, according to researchers here. [more]
One Cannabis Joint Equals Smoking Up to Five Cigarettes
WELLINGTON, New Zealand — Smoking a single marijuana joint by a heavy user can cause bronchial damage similar to smoking 2.5 to five cigarettes, researchers reported. [more]
More Evidence of Harm from Smoking During Pregnancy
UTRECHT, Netherlands — Exposure to tobacco smoke before birth may raise blood pressure substantially in infancy, which could have consequences later in life, researchers here said.
